Municipal garbage has good value as fuel. We used to design waste to energy incinerators for the USA, and got good thermal value from them, until the EPA declared the incinerator ash as hazardous waste, and refused to consider any technically feasible methods of inerting the waste. This killed them, economically. If you have a saner environmental agency, it could work.
